Understanding Carbon-Neutral Supply Chains

What is a Carbon-Neutral Supply Chain?

A carbon-neutral supply chain is one that actively seeks to reduce its carbon emissions to net-zero. This is typically achieved through a combination of reducing emissions at various stages of production and transportation, along with investing in renewable energy and carbon offset initiatives. By adopting these practices, companies not only meet modern consumer demands but also contribute positively to environmental well-being.

The Role of Autonomous Buying Agents

Streamlining Procurement Processes

Autonomous buying agents enhance efficiency in procurement processes. By leveraging data analytics, these agents can identify suppliers who align with carbon-neutral practices. This not only simplifies sourcing decisions but also encourages suppliers to implement greener practices in order to stay competitive.

Data-Driven Decision Making

The decision-making capabilities of autonomous buying agents are grounded in data insights. By analyzing trends and supplier environmental impact reports, these agents prioritize partners with sustainable practices. They help businesses make informed choices about their supply chains, ultimately leading to reduced carbon footprints.

FAQs About Autonomous Buying Agents and Carbon-Neutral Practices

How do autonomous buying agents find carbon-neutral suppliers?

Autonomous buying agents utilize data analytics and machine learning to assess suppliers against a diversity of metrics. These include emissions data, sustainability certifications, and compliance records, ensuring a holistic evaluation.

What are the challenges of implementing carbon-neutral supply chains?

Implementing carbon-neutral supply chains can be complex. Challenges include supplier readiness, the need for transparency throughout the supply chain, and initial costs related to adopting sustainable practices.

Are there measurable benefits to carbon-neutral supply chains?

Yes, companies often experience reduced operational costs, improved regulatory compliance, enhanced brand loyalty, and increased market access as they move towards carbon-neutral supply chains.
